Adelaide Stayer Wins City Tattersalls Cup

Tara Madgwick - Saturday October 23

It only seems fitting that on Cox Plate Day, the 2014 Cox Plate hero Adelaide (IRE) would sire a new stakes-winner with his progressive staying son Torrens taking out the Listed ATC City Tattersalls Cup (2400m) at Randwick.

Torrens wins the City Tattersalls Cup - image Steve Hart

The Lauri Parker trained stallion has been racing well this preparation recording wins at Randwick and Warwick Farm with a last start eighth in the $500,000 St Leger after doing plenty of work from a wide gate.

He enjoyed a better run with cover this time and when angled into the clear by Jenny Duggan, Torrens let down with a good run to reel in the leader and win by three-quarters of a length running away.
 


Torrens was retained to race by his breeder and has won eight races and placed three times from 26 starts earning over $334,000 in prizemoney.

Jenny Duggan celebrates her first stakes victory!
 

Torrens is the best of three winners from winning dangerous mare A Little Knowledge, who comes from the family of Group I winner Select Prince. She died in 2019 and her last foal is an unnamed three year-old colt by Adelaide.

Torrens has been a good money earner and is the second stakes-winner for his sire Adelaide, who is best known as the sire of Group I winning mare Funstar, who sold as a broodmare prospect this year for $2.7 million.

Adelaide (IRE), click for more information.

By legendary sire Galileo, Adelaide is a value option on the Coolmore roster priced at just $5,500 this spring.
